SK D&D seals deal with Glennmont to invest in solar PV projects in South Korea

South Korea-based renewable energy SK D&D has signed shareholders agreement with Glennmont Partners from Nuveen (Glennmont), one of the world’s largest fund managers investing in clean energy based in the United Kingdom, to establish a joint venture company for the co-investment of solar photovoltaics (PV) projects in South Korea. 

MetaComp gets nod to provide digital payment token services in Singapore

Singapore-based cryptocurrency exchange MetaComp Pte. Ltd. has been awarded a licence from the Monetary Authority of Singapore (MAS) to provide digital payment token services as a major payment institution in Singapore.

Hong Kong’s FWD partners Malaysia’s Artem Ventures to launch $10.22M fund

FWD Group Holdings Limited (FWD Group) has on Thursday announced the launch of TIM Ventures, a MYR45 million ($10.22 million) venture capital fund in collaboration with Artem Ventures, a Malaysia-based venture capital firm, to invest in emerging start-ups in the insurtech and Islamic fintech space in Malaysia.

South Korea’s BigBang Angels to establish global venture fund in Singapore with Farquhar Venture Capital

South Korean early-stage accelerator and venture capital (VC) Bigbang Angels (BBA) has on Thursday announced its formation of a global investment fund and deepens its footprint in South East Asia, by cementing its partnership with Singapore homegrown early-stage innovation ecosystem enabler, Farquhar Venture Capital (FVC).

SCB 10X launches Web3 collaboration hub for international community-building in Bangkok

SCB 10X, the venture investment arm of SCBX group, announced Thursday the launch of SCB 10X DISTRICTX, a physical space in the middle of Bangkok central business district (CBD) to build and foster world-class communities in blockchain and Web3.
